How does a steel wedge work?

The operation of a steel wedge (or adjustment wedge) is based on the law of the inclined plane. The sharper the angle of the wedge, the greater the spreading or splitting force that can be exerted with it. When a steel wedge is driven between two objects, its tapered shape converts horizontal striking force into powerful vertical leverage. This allows heavy materials and machine parts to be set or pushed into place with extreme precision with minimal effort.

Maximum Stability: Self-Inhibiting and Safe

In heavy industry and civil engineering, shape retention is essential. Where softer steels can deform under extreme pressure, C45 steel maintains its integrity.

The advantages of the Euronique form:

  • Self-braking ability: Our wedges are cut at a specific, safe angle of inclination. This makes the wedge self-inhibiting; the friction is high enough to prevent the wedge from slipping out of the joint under load or vibration.

  • Angled back: Our wedges have one completely flat side. This keeps the force vector aimed purely vertically, resulting in unwavering alignment without the wedge “walking.

  • Safety: Each wedge is carefully deburred. This prevents cuts to mechanics and ensures a tight fit in tight openings.

Applications: From Concrete Saw to Machine Foundation

Our steel mounting wedges are used daily in various industries:

  • Mechanical engineering: Accurate leveling of heavy process plants on concrete foundations.
  • Concrete and Sawing Technology: For direct relief of cuts in cable cutting or concrete drilling to prevent pinching.

  • Steel construction: leveling columns and beams before final welding or casting.

  • Welding technology: As a robust aid for aligning and clamping workpieces.

Material choice: When do you choose steel, aluminum or bronze?

While our C45 steel wedges are the standard for heavy-duty construction, specific work environments require a different material. At Euronique, we recommend based on your application:

  • Corrosion Resistance & Weight: In shipbuilding or light assembly jobs, our aluminum wedges offer a solution. Aluminum is significantly lighter to handle and completely resistant to salt water and oxidation.

  • Low-spark environments (ATEX): Do you work in petrochemicals or an environment with explosion hazard? For safe flange maintenance and spark-free setting, we supply high-quality bronze wedges. Bronze prevents mechanical sparking on impact and is essential for safety in ATEX zones.

Ease of disassembly: When to choose a head wedge?

For many alignment jobs, a standard steel leveling wedge is sufficient. However, for temporary mounting or situations where the wedge needs to be removed again after some time, we recommend our steel head wedges.

A head wedge features a raised “nose” on the thick side. This offers a great advantage during disassembly: you can easily knock the wedge loose again or pull it out with a crowbar, even if it is stuck under extreme tension. Our head wedges, like the standard adjusting wedges, have a self-locking angle for maximum safety during use.

What is the advantage of an angled (single-tap) wedge over a double-tap wedge?
An angled wedge (with one completely flat side) provides significantly more stability during the adjustment process. While a double-tapered wedge tends to “wander” or slip sideways under pressure, the flat back of our steel adjusting wedges provides clean, vertical force transmission. This is essential for accurate machine alignment.
